== Flight pods in the finale ==
The finale shows that ''Galactica'' doesn't need to retract the flight pods to jump, it's just a good idea otherwise your combat-landed Vipers might go flying out the end (I'm hoping those Vipers powered up in time before they splattered on the Moon's surface).--[[User:Werthead|Werthead]] 00:18, 23 March 2009 (UTC)
:I think it would be more accurate to say that ''Galactica'' *shouldn't* jump without retracting the flightpods.  We can't definitively say that it safely can, since the one time it did (other than continuity errors showing the flightpods extended when jumping but retracted when emerging from the jump) results in structural failure.-- [[User:Fredmdbud|Fredmdbud]] 04:04, 19 May 2009 (UTC)
== The nuke: only kiloton? ==
Although we know Lee managed to lure Raiders by mimicking the release of EM from a 50 Kt nuke, to convince the Cylon ships of the destruction of Colonial One, we could assert that the Raiders were not looking for an exact quantification of the explosion. They were, after all, fooled by a transponder put on board a Raptor flying close to Cylon patrols and even a Basestar.
I think the fiendish Raiders just noticed a big light and didn't start counting the rems.
We also know from Razor that during the holocaust, the Raiders had enough firepower to cause impressive damage to battleships parked at the Scorpion Yards.
Besides, the official Miniseries Novelization clarifies the execution of the bombardment of Caprica and makes it crystal clear that the 50 MT nukes were lobbed by Raiders.
We saw that even Raptors could fire small and yet god-awfully powerful nukes at the Cylon Colony, nukes so powerful they literally made the station rotate upon impact, and we know that as we see internal explosions on the other side of the Colony, running down the arm which the Galactica is close to, that the energy of the explosions caused by the nukes finds its origins, for a large part, from the nukes themselves.
As per Baltar's words, under the right pressure and heat, blowing up tylium could give you 500 TJ/kg. That's impressive and fits with powerful multi-megaton warheads carried by small crafts.
The destruction of the Cylon Hub by four nukes fired by two Vipers Mk-VII, destroying the Cylon Hub and, with the released energy (with four explosions being relatively identical regardless of their point of impact), also destroying a nearby Basestar, would support the existence of such high yield nuclear ordnance for small crafts. --[[User:Mister Oragahn|Mister Oragahn]] 01:42, 19 May 2009 (UTC)
